What is Alpha?

If you are new to small groups or exploring the Christian Faith, then Alpha Small Groups are the place to be. The format is simple: we watch a video and then we have a small group conversation that explores life, spirituality, and faith through a Christian lens. Whether you’re a skeptic, curious about faith or a growing Christ-follower, we create a non-judgmental and open environment where it’s easy for anyone to explore questions of life together.

How does it work?

Welcome

15 -30 Minutes | Introductions
Welcome and meet some new people. For some groups, this time includes a light meal. 

Watch

25 Minutes | Short Films with Big Ideas
Each Alpha group features a 25-minute film. Designed to inspire more questions than provide answers, these short films explore the big issues around faith and unpack the basics of Christianity, addressing questions such as Who is Jesus? How can we have faith? We will watch the film each week together whether the meeting in-person or online.

Discuss

30 – 45 Minutes | Discuss the Questions That Matter To You
Online groups last 30 minutes. In-person groups last closer to 45 minutes. The entire group time builds towards this peak experience. After the film, you will be put into a virtual breakout room and your hosts will facilitate conversations in small groups where you can share your thoughts about faith and life and hear from others in your group. The film is where we say what we think, but this time is when you get to say what you think. We really want to hear your thoughts and opinions. We will put you in a group with friends or family that have invited you, and if you selected “skeptic, curious, or growing Christ-follower” in your registration, we’ll try to match you up with others who selected the same self-description.
